Step #1:
- The longer you keep your homemade meal on ice the more you increase your chances for success. Remember, the clock starts ticking when you take your frozen homemade meal out of the freezer, and ends when your homemade meal is delivered to your loved one.
- Do not send your homemade meal at the end of the week. Send them at the beginning of the week so they don't sit in the back of a truck or mailing facility over the weekend. As a general rule, we recommend targeting delivery no later than Thursday of each week, unless you're shipping packages with a guaranteed delivery date. Additionally, be mindful of holidays by checking out our Carrier Holiday Schedule link.
- Are there things you can do to reduce your shipping costs and have your package processed faster? Absolutely. Undoubtedly by dropping off your package at an authorized FedEx, or UPS store may speed-up the processing time and you'll save money by doing so. Check with your local authorized FedEx, or UPS store for details regarding the latest time you can drop off your package.
- Save a few dollars with FedEx and UPS shipping by using our helpful 'Save on Shipping' module on the previous page. This provides you with the nearest drop off locations in your area.
- Shipments requiring three or less travel days can be shipped by Ground transportation. Shipments requiring more than three days for delivery should be shipped using 2nd day Air.
- If your scheduling a residential pickup, keep the container with you until the driver comes to the door. If you're going out keep in a shaded location outside your home protected from the elements.
- Consider sending your package from work. This way you can keep your food container, refrigerants or possibly the entire Insulated Container Kit on ice depending how large your company's freezer is. Did you ever notice at work how the refrigerator is always full of lunches and the freezer is always empty? Why not take advantage of this!
